Signal and Power Integrity (SI/PI) Design Engineer
Responsibilities:
Responsible for chip-level and system-level SI/PI analysis;
Familiar with high-speed IP interface solutions such as SerDes, PCIe, USB, HDMI, MIPI, DDR/LPDDR, and responsible for high-speed interface simulation and test analysis to ensure chip and system high-speed performance;
Perform end-to-end power integrity analysis to ensure chip and system power performance, and conduct related simulation and testing analysis;
Responsible for system-level SI/PI design definition, responsible for design stage Pre-layout and Post-layout analysis, and provide guidance for layout design.
Requirements:
Bachelor’s degree or above, majoring in Electronic Engineering, Integrated Circuits, Electromagnetic Fields, Microwave, RF and other related majors;
Experience in signal integrity, power integrity, hardware development and PCB board development and design is preferred;
Proficient in the use of Sigrity, ADS, HFSS, Hspice and other simulation tools;
Familiar with Python, TCL, Perl and other languages, able to use different languages for development according to the needs of different simulation tools, matlab programming ability is a plus;
Solid signal integrity and power integrity simulation, testing and analysis skills;
Familiar with PCB or Package process, material, lamination, processing, and manufacturing process;
Self-driven, team player, good communication and presentation skills.
